michael@0 70 ////////////////////////////////////////////////////////////////
michael@0 71 // UniqueString
michael@0 72 //
michael@0 73 class UniqueString {
michael@0 74 public:
michael@0 75 UniqueString(string str) { str_ = strdup(str.c_str()); }
michael@0 76 ~UniqueString() { free(reinterpret_cast<void*>(const_cast<char*>(str_))); }
michael@0 77 const char* str_;
michael@0 78 };
michael@0 79
michael@0 80 class UniqueStringUniverse {
michael@0 81 public:
michael@0 82 UniqueStringUniverse() {};
michael@0 83 const UniqueString* FindOrCopy(string str) {
michael@0 84 std::map<string, UniqueString*>::iterator it = map_.find(str);
michael@0 85 if (it == map_.end()) {
michael@0 86 UniqueString* ustr = new UniqueString(str);
michael@0 87 map_[str] = ustr;
michael@0 88 return ustr;
michael@0 89 } else {
michael@0 90 return it->second;
michael@0 91 }
michael@0 92 }
michael@0 93 private:
michael@0 94 std::map<string, UniqueString*> map_;
michael@0 95 };
michael@0 96
michael@0 97
michael@0 98 const UniqueString* ToUniqueString(string str) {
michael@0 99 // For the initialisation of sUniverse to be threadsafe,
michael@0 100 // this relies on C++11's semantics.
michael@0 101 static UniqueStringUniverse sUniverse;
michael@0 102 return sUniverse.FindOrCopy(str);
michael@0 103 }
michael@0 104
michael@0 105 const char* const FromUniqueString(const UniqueString* ustr)
michael@0 106 {
michael@0 107 return ustr->str_;
michael@0 108 }
michael@0 109
michael@0 110 } // namespace lul
